First we build a four-digit number on the place-value mat. We build 3,072 digit by digit and read it aloud, watching the zeros: the zero in the hundreds column holds the place so the 3 stays in the thousands. After we have read that one, we will build another four-digit number, 4,905, on the board mat beside it and read that aloud too.
Now we change task, from building numbers to renaming a length. Renaming a length means writing the same length two ways, using a different unit. We know 1 m = 100 cm, so to change metres into centimetres we multiply by 100. That means 2 m = 2 × 100 = 200 cm, and 3 m = 3 × 100 = 300 cm. It is the same length, just written in a smaller unit.

Today we sort four sets in order, each a step trickier than the last. First sort numbers into odd and even. Then sort lengths into shorter than a metre and longer than a metre. Then sort shapes into triangles and quadrilaterals. The last set is different: instead of sorting a card by a property, you decide whether each statement is true. Say what test you are using before each reveal.
